Step 1: Containment and Extraction
Our technicians arrive at your property and begin containing the affected area using specialized equipment, such as plastic sheets and tarps, to prevent further damage. Next, we extract the sewage water using powerful pumps and vacuums, removing any visible signs of contamination.
Step 2: Moisture Detection and Metering
Using advanced moisture detection equipment, we identify hidden areas of moisture and map the affected areas to develop a comprehensive restoration plan. This step is crucial in preventing further structural damage and ensuring a thorough clean-up.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
With our commercial-grade dehumidifiers and air movers, we accelerate the drying process, reducing the risk of mold growth and further damage. This step is critical in restoring your property to a safe and habitable state.
Step 4: Sanitizing and Cleaning
Our technicians sanitize and clean the affected area, using specialized cleaning solutions and equipment to remove any remaining contaminants. This final step ensures your property is safe for you and your family to return to.

Sewage Water Removal Cost in Cedarburg, WI
The cost of sewage water remov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Cedarburg, WI. Our team will provide a detailed estimate after inspecting your property and assessing the damage.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Containment and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, complexity of the situation |
| Moisture Detection and Metering |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, level of moisture damage |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, level of moisture damage |
| Sanitizing and Cleaning |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, level of contamination |
| Inspection and Assessment | $0 – $500 | Free initial inspection, optional more assessment |
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ment and the specific requirements of your situation. We offer free estimates and will work with you to develop a personalized restoration plan that fits your budget and needs.
